Agrim Koirala, a fourteen year old child, is diagnosed with ALL B-cell leukemia (Blood cancer) in April 2021. He was taken to a hospital after cancerous symptoms like pale skin, shortness of breath, compromised immunity and weight loss that hindered the fourteen year old's ability of normal life.

Currently, Agrim is admitted to hospital for over a month. His little body has endured over 30 chemotherapy treatments for past two months. His parents have sold their land in order to pay for the exorbitant treatment costs. The extravagant medical expense of chemotherapy and hospitalisation has dragged his parents into debt. Now, he is required to do four cycles of chemo, bone marrow transplant, and immune therapy which his parents can no longer afford. Medical debt summed by COVID-19 lockdown has made the situation worse. With little hope of saving the life of their child, but barred by financial necessity, we have come to this solution.
Once a very bright kid no longer can continue his education. He cannot enjoy life as a normal fourteen-year-old and is spending his days surrounded by doctors and nurses all the time.
